2013-09-03 4 views
2

La journalisation interne de ServiceStack n'est pas quelque chose que je veux avoir dans mes journaux. Comment désactiver la journalisation interne, ou au moins la supprimer afin qu'elle n'obstrue pas le journal?Désactiver la journalisation ServiceStack

+0

Cela semble être lié: http://stackoverflow.com/questions/18868410/servicestack-how-to-disable-default- exception-logging – Anthony

Répondre

4

Lors de la configuration de votre LogManager suffit de le mettre à une instance de NullLogFactory

LogManager.LogFactory = new NullLogFactory(); 
+0

Je veux toujours pouvoir me connecter, je ne veux pas que la journalisation interne de ServiceStack obstrue ma journalisation actuelle. Je voudrais désactiver la journalisation interne de ServiceStack (sans recompiler ServiceStack). – mariocatch

+1

Dans ce cas, vous pouvez définir EndpointHostConfig.DebugMode = false – Dve

+0

La définition de DebugMode sur false n'a pas fonctionné pour moi - il y a toujours des erreurs ServiceStack internes. Exemple: ServiceStack.Host.Handlers.NotFoundHttpHandler –

Questions connexes